Data: Bitcoin spot ETF had a total net inflow of 175 million USD yesterday, continuing a net inflow for 3 days

2026-09-05 12:24:47

According to SoSoValue data, the total net inflow for Bitcoin spot ETFs is $175 million. The Bitcoin spot ETF with the highest net inflow in a single day is Blackrock ETF IBIT, with a net inflow of $117 million in one day, and the historical total net inflow for IBIT has reached $64.057 billion.

Following that is Fidelity ETF FBTC, with a single-day net inflow of $57.2183 million, and the historical total net inflow for FBTC has reached $10.333 billion. As of the time of publication, the total net asset value of Bitcoin spot ETFs is $101.252 billion, with an ETF net asset ratio (market value compared to the total market value of Bitcoin) of 6.33%, and the historical cumulative net inflow has reached $55.618 billion.
